From c93cd6186a94c916da2c6bea5f0ba1f35ca7ddb4 Mon Sep 17 00:00:00 2001 From: Alexandre Aubin Date: Sat, 26 Nov 2016 21:24:56 -0500 Subject: [PATCH] [enh] Automatically create user vagrant in use-git yunohost-admin (e.g. when running in a VPS) --- ynh-dev |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/ynh-dev b/ynh-dev index 2257383..402f985 100755 --- a/ynh-dev +++ b/ynh-dev @@ -251,6 +251,13 @@ elif [ "$1" = "use-git" ]; then ;; yunohost-admin) + # Trick to check vagrant user exists (for install on VPS..) + getent passwd vagrant > /dev/null + if [ $? -eq 2 ]; then + useradd vagrant + chown -R vagrant: /vagrant/yunohost-admin + fi + # Install npm dependencies if needed which gulp > /dev/null if [ $? -eq 1 ]